Triconex 3515 Pulse Input Module (Industrial-Grade High-Frequency Signal Processor)

The Triconex 3515 represents a specialized pulse counting solution engineered for safety-instrumented systems where signal integrity and continuous availability are non-negotiable. This 8-channel module processes high-frequency pulse trains from turbine flowmeters, proximity probes, and encoder devices while maintaining Triple Modular Redundant (TMR) fault tolerance throughout the entire signal path.

Designed for industries where equipment overspeed, flow measurement errors, or position tracking failures can trigger catastrophic events, the 3515 delivers deterministic performance under IEC 61508 SIL 3 requirements. Its architecture eliminates single points of failure through triplicated input circuitry, independent A/D conversion, and majority-voted processing—ensuring that sensor faults, wiring issues, or component degradation never compromise system integrity.

Whether you're protecting turbomachinery in oil & gas facilities, totalizing critical process flows in chemical plants, or monitoring conveyor positioning in automated production lines, the 3515 provides the reliability foundation your safety layer demands. Hot-swappable design and comprehensive diagnostics minimize planned and unplanned downtime while maintaining full operational transparency.

Core Capabilities & Technical Advantages

→ Triple Modular Redundant Signal Processing
Three independent input channels per logical point continuously compare readings and vote out discrepancies in real-time. This architecture maintains accurate counting even when individual components fail, delivering 99.99% availability in safety-critical loops without requiring system shutdown for repairs.

→ 10 kHz Maximum Input Frequency
Captures fast-rotating shaft speeds, high-velocity flow pulses, and rapid event sequences that standard I/O modules cannot track. Wide frequency range (DC to 10 kHz) accommodates both slow-speed monitoring and high-performance applications within a single module platform.

→ 32-Bit Accumulator Resolution
Each channel maintains a 32-bit counter capable of tracking over 4 billion pulses before rollover, eliminating the need for frequent software resets in long-duration totalizing applications. Configurable scaling and gate timing enable direct engineering unit conversion.

→ 1500V Channel-to-Backplane Isolation
Protects sensitive controller circuitry from field-side electrical transients, ground loops, and voltage surges common in industrial environments. Isolation barriers prevent fault propagation between I/O channels and the control backplane, enhancing overall system robustness.

✓ Hot-Swappable Maintenance
Replace failed modules during operation without interrupting process control or safety functions. Automatic configuration download and TMR synchronization restore full redundancy within seconds of module insertion, reducing mean time to repair (MTTR) by up to 75%.

✓ Comprehensive Built-In Diagnostics
Continuous self-testing monitors input signal quality, power supply health, and internal processing integrity. Diagnostic data accessible through TriStation software enables predictive maintenance and rapid fault isolation without external test equipment.

Application Scenarios & Industry Solutions

Turbomachinery Overspeed Protection
In gas turbine and steam turbine installations, the 3515 monitors shaft speed via magnetic pickups or proximity probes, triggering emergency shutdown systems when rotational velocity exceeds safe thresholds. TMR voting ensures that sensor failures or wiring faults never cause spurious trips or—more critically—fail to detect genuine overspeed conditions. Typical deployment: dual-redundant speed sensors feeding independent 3515 channels with 2oo3 voting logic.

Custody Transfer Flow Measurement
Chemical processing and pipeline operations rely on the 3515 for fiscal-grade flow totalizing where measurement accuracy directly impacts revenue and regulatory compliance. The module integrates with turbine flowmeters to accumulate volumetric totals while detecting flow anomalies that indicate meter degradation, process upsets, or potential leaks. SIL 3 certification satisfies safety requirements for hazardous fluid handling.

High-Speed Packaging Line Control
Automated filling, capping, and labeling systems use the 3515 to track product position, count completed units, and synchronize multi-axis motion. Precise pulse counting at speeds exceeding 600 units/minute ensures accurate product delivery while safety interlocks prevent equipment damage during jam conditions or emergency stops.

Conveyor Position Tracking
Material handling systems in mining, cement, and bulk processing facilities employ the 3515 with incremental encoders to monitor belt position, detect slip conditions, and calculate throughput rates. Fault-tolerant counting prevents loss of position reference during encoder failures, maintaining production continuity and preventing material spillage.

Emergency Shutdown System Integration
Safety instrumented systems (SIS) protecting against runaway reactions, pressure excursions, or equipment failures incorporate the 3515 for monitoring critical process variables derived from pulse signals. The module's proven-in-use status and extensive failure mode analysis simplify SIL verification calculations and regulatory approval processes.

Technical Parameters & Selection Guide

ParameterSpecificationNotes
Input Channels8 independent TMR channelsEach channel triplicated internally
Frequency RangeDC to 10 kHzPer channel, simultaneous operation
Input Voltage10-30 VDC nominalDry contact or active sensor compatible
Counter Width32-bit per channel4,294,967,296 count capacity
Safety IntegritySIL 3 per IEC 61508Certified for safety-critical applications
Isolation Voltage1500 VDC continuousChannel-to-backplane protection
Operating Temp0°C to 60°CExtended range: -40°C to 70°C (consult factory)
Power Draw5W typicalSupplied via I/O backplane
MTBF>200,000 hoursBased on Telcordia SR-332 analysis

Selection Criteria:

Choose the 3515 when your application requires SIL 2/3 certification, input frequencies exceed 1 kHz, or system availability targets demand fault-tolerant I/O. For non-safety applications with lower channel counts, consider standard pulse input modules. If you need more than 8 channels, the Triconex 3510 (16-channel variant) offers higher density in the same footprint. Applications involving quadrature encoders benefit from dedicated encoder modules that provide direction sensing and position tracking beyond simple pulse counting.

Verify that your sensor output voltage and current drive capability match the 3515 input specifications—most proximity probes and NPN/PNP sensors interface directly, while passive magnetic pickups may require signal conditioning. Consult factory application engineers for complex installations involving long cable runs (>100m) or electrically noisy environments.

Frequently Asked Questions

How does the 3515 handle noisy pulse signals in industrial environments?
The module incorporates programmable input filtering with adjustable time constants (10 µs to 10 ms) to reject electrical noise while preserving signal edges. Schmitt trigger input circuitry provides hysteresis that prevents false triggering from slow-rising waveforms or contact bounce. For severe EMI environments, external RC filtering or shielded cabling may be recommended—our application engineers can specify appropriate solutions based on your installation details.

Can I use the 3515 for bidirectional counting applications?
The 3515 is optimized for unidirectional pulse accumulation. For applications requiring up/down counting or quadrature encoder tracking (direction sensing), consider the Triconex 3511 Encoder Input Module, which provides dedicated A/B channel processing and position tracking functionality.

What happens to accumulated counts during power loss or module replacement?
Count values are maintained in controller memory, not within the 3515 module itself. During power interruptions, the Triconex controller's battery-backed RAM preserves all accumulated totals. When replacing a 3515 module, counting resumes from the last stored value without data loss—the new module automatically synchronizes with the controller's current count state.

Does the 3515 support remote monitoring and diagnostics?
Yes, comprehensive diagnostic data including input signal status, TMR voting discrepancies, and module health indicators are accessible through TriStation software locally or via secure remote connections. Integration with plant-wide asset management systems enables centralized monitoring of all installed 3515 modules across multiple control systems.

What is the maximum cable length between sensors and the 3515 module?
Typical installations support cable runs up to 300 meters (1000 feet) using shielded twisted-pair wiring with proper grounding practices. Longer distances may require signal repeaters or 4-20mA transmitters to maintain signal integrity. Specific recommendations depend on sensor output characteristics, cable type, and electromagnetic environment—consult our technical documentation or contact support for site-specific guidance.

How do I verify proper operation after installation?
TriStation software provides built-in diagnostic tools including forced input simulation, count verification, and TMR channel comparison displays. The module's self-test routines continuously monitor internal circuitry and report any anomalies through diagnostic registers. For field verification, apply known pulse trains using a function generator and compare accumulated counts against expected values—detailed test procedures are included in the installation manual.
